Characteristics of Mini Yorkshire Terriers
Mini Yorkies are a smaller sized variation of the standard Yorkshire Terrier, typically weighing between 3 to 7 pounds and standing about 7 to 8 inches tall at the shoulder. Although they are small in stature, their personalities are anything however! Below are some crucial qualities that specify Mini Yorkshire Terriers.
CharacteristicDescriptionSize3 to 7 poundsHeight7 to 8 inchesLife expectancy12 to 15 yearsCoat TypeSilky, long, and straight with a blue and tan colorPersonalityEnergetic, affectionate, smartGrooming NeedsHigh (routine brushing and grooming needed)Exercise NeedsModerate (everyday walks and playtime)Personality Traits
Mini Yorkshire Terriers are energetic and spirited dogs. They prosper on human companionship and delight in being the center of attention. Their intelligence makes them fast learners, but they can also exhibit a persistent streak. Socializing them from an early age is vital to guarantee they become well-rounded grownups. Mini Yorkies love to bark, which makes them great guard dogs, but their small size implies they are less efficient as guard dogs.
Care Requirements
Taking care of a Mini Yorkshire Terrier requires commitment and consistency. Due to their small size, they have particular needs that owners need to know.
NutritionKind of FoodDescriptionIndustrial Dog FoodPremium dry kibble tailored for little typesHomemade DietNeed to seek advice from a veterinarian to ensure well balanced nutrition
Mini Yorkies have little stomachs and require a diet that includes premium canine food that is particularly formulated for little breeds. It's vital to monitor their weight to avoid obesity, which can cause health problems. Treats need to be given sparingly, as their caloric requirements are reasonably low.
GroomingGrooming TaskFrequencyBrushing2-3 times each weekBathingRegular monthly or as requiredNail TrimmingEvery couple of weeksEar CleaningWeekly or as required
Due to their long, streaming coats, Mini Yorkies need routine grooming to prevent matting and tangles. Owners need to brush their fur at least 2-3 times a week and bathe them as soon as a month or when essential. Regular nail cutting and ear cleaning are also crucial for total health.
WorkoutActivityDescriptionDaily Walks20-30 minutes per dayPlaytimeInteractive video games (fetch, tug-of-war)SocializationTrips to pet parks or pet-friendly environments
Mini Yorkies have moderate workout needs. They enjoy day-to-day walks and play sessions to keep them fit and psychologically stimulated. Socialization is necessary for their advancement, so regular interactions with other dogs and individuals are recommended.
Health Considerations
Like all types, Mini Yorkshire Terriers can be vulnerable to certain health issues. Owners ought to understand the following:
Health IssueDescriptionDental ProblemsLittle mouths can result in overcrowded teethLuxating PatellaDislocation of the kneecap, typical in little breedsTracheal CollapseWeakened trachea leading to difficulty breathingHypoglycemiaLow blood glucose levels, particularly in puppies
Routine veterinary check-ups are vital to monitor their health and catch any prospective concerns early. Simple dental care at home can also help prevent oral illness, a typical concern among small types.

Are Mini Yorkshire Terriers great with kids?
While Mini Yorkies can be affectionate towards kids, they may not be the finest choice for very young kids due to their delicate size. Guidance is important during interactions.
2. How typically should I take my Mini Yorkie to the veterinarian?
Regular veterinarian check-ups every 6 to 12 months are suggested to monitor their health and receive vaccinations.
3. Do Mini Yorkies shed?
Mini Yorkies are considered low-shedding dogs, however routine grooming is still required to prevent matting.
4. Can Mini Yorkies be left alone for long durations?
Though they can endure being alone for a couple of hours, prolonged solitude can result in separation anxiety. They flourish on companionship.
